Transaction e617df61ca249639d761e89aa0b2d83b130b75bdc7a1691580daf9ddbc0cdc55
1 Input
1 Output
-
e617df61ca249639d761e89aa0b2d83b130b75bdc7a1691580daf9ddbc0cdc55:0
- value
- 17763050
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dbd642933b6298544c439b6490d4f2199ffc385 OP_EQUAL
- address
- 32wfbAxiRLj5T2DNpp2Ws3NzB8eJb6W86w